| 1 | Unto thee lift I up mine eyes, O thou that dwellest in the heavens. | 
| 2 | Behold, as the eyes of servants look unto the hand of their masters, and as the eyes of a maiden unto the hand of her mistress; so our eyes wait upon the LORD our God, until that he have mercy upon us. | 
| 3 | Have mercy upon us, O LORD, have mercy upon us: for we are exceedingly filled with contempt. | 
| 4 | Our soul is exceedingly filled with the scorning of those that are at ease, and with the contempt of the proud.
